as i recall, your program does some magic to access mpc files from a cf card or whatever before the computer os does.

can you talk a bit about this? like, what is a good procedure to mount a cf card from my mpc so your program gets it before macos turns it into garbage? do you start the program first, then connect the card reader?

i am aware it's still being worked on and so it's probably best to have backups and do this on a test card first.

In the Java version of vMPC there was a CF/USB FAT16 reader. In the current version of vMPC this will be implemented at some point, but it currently isn't.

I can't remember clearly the details of retaining the MPC's 16.3 file names. For Windows I'm pretty sure it doesn't start messing things up on the CF until you use Explorer or a similar application to modify a file. Nothing is messed up just yet when you simply read a volume, even though it looks different to how the 2KXL would show you the volume content.

For OSX I vaguely remember having to turn off one or more services related to Finder, like indexing and creation of .DS_Store perhaps, to achieve something similar. But I'm less sure of this. I'll have to play around with OSX once more to see what's going on.

Cool you remember this feature though, it's one of my favorites. I'll add it to the feature requests and hopefully start working on it this month or the next one.

yeah on windows (not in the vmpc software) it would screw up if you used 16.3 while naming files on the mpc by replacing some characters with ~ .. that is why it is recommended to use 8 characters while naming on the mpc. it saves on fixing the file names later and rebuilding the program on the mpc when you reload a project.
